I'm kind of running out of options as I can't seem to find Ortec NIM
module manuals anywhere. In particular ,I'm looking for the operating
manual for the Ortec 7450 Multi Channel Analyzer. I'd be willing to
pay a decent price for a copy if any one has it. Thanks. jk

IIRC that product was made for ORTEC by the long since departed
Norland, a maker of DSO's and the like. But you note this is NIM
based ... I remember ORTEC having the 800 series of NIM ADC's.

And I also remember, but then the mind isn't as clear as it used to be
:-) that Viking Instruments (I think in Madison WI) took up some
warranty for those products in the '90's -- maybe if you can find
them, you can get some help?
